How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Philadelphia?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Philadelphia Studio Apartments | $1,615 | $500 | $5,905 |
| Philadelphia 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,003 | $545 | $10,000+ |
| Philadelphia 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,491 | $499 | $10,000+ |
| Philadelphia 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,955 | $793 | $10,000+ |
| Philadelphia 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,935 | $585 | $10,000+ |
| Philadelphia 5 Bedroom Apartments | $3,425 | $1,550 | $10,000+ |
| Philadelphia 6 Bedroom Apartments | $3,026 | $525 | $4,950 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Philadelphia
How much are Studio apartments in Philadelphia?
There are currently 2,987 Studio Apartments in Philadelphia with rent ranges from $500 to $5,905 with an average price of $1,615.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Philadelphia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Philadelphia ranges from $545 to $10,990 with an average monthly rent of $2,003.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Philadelphia c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Philadelphia range from $499 to $22,000.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,491.
How expensive are Philadelphia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 1,228 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Philadelphia on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$793 to $19,920 - averaging $2,955 for the location.
